Cursed Money Synopsis

On the Eve of WW2, the royal government of Yugoslavia hid the national money inside the cave around village of Ozrinići in Montenegro. The locals discovered the heaps of money by accident, and soon begun to build new houses and buy the land. Unfortunately, the Italians occupied the country and burned their properties to ashes. Based on a true story.

Cursed Money (1956) is a comedy and war film directed by Velimir Stojanović, released on January 1, 1956 with a runtime of 1h 46m. It stars Dubravka Gall, Antun Nalis, Ljuba Tadić and Vaso Perišić. Viewers rate it 6.3 out of 10 across 4 ratings.
